Output 2854061aa757d7f5a9534d627a232355b4a228126f7b3464c0baf91c19142e5d:8

value
6435000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ac1446d42e4928294b733c147372fb74363b0206 OP_EQUAL
address
3HNtSPP23vyXuehKyRuzEtcmGSHNkHg6ze
transaction
2854061aa757d7f5a9534d627a232355b4a228126f7b3464c0baf91c19142e5d
confirmations
282376
spent
true